The World Bank Board of Directors approved a $48 million Development Policy Financing (DPF) operation for Mauritania …Take time to let the cat become accustomed to the carrier or travel crate well before the journey. Make it a pleasant place to be – feed the cat treats inside it and make a cosy bed of familiar smelling bedding which can be used on the journey. Small cats and dogs will be allowed on specific domestic flights with the …May 28, 2013 · Below is a checklist of items we suggest taking with you when traveling with one cat (increase quantities as needed for multiple cats). Food and snacks/treats. Fresh water, preferably bottled or brought from home. Bowls (2) Clean cat litter. Clean litter pan. Brush or grooming tools. Any medications. Pet first-aid kit. Healthy cats can comfortably travel in their carrier for 2-4 hours before needing a break. In some cases, cats may even have to stay in their carriers for 6, 8, or 10 hours total. All dogs and cats, regardless of age (puppies and kittens included) or purpose, must comply with Hawaii’s dog and cat import requirements. Chapter 4-29 Hawaii Administrative Rules, governs the importation of dogs, cats and other carnivores into Hawaii.
